# Not likely.
Almost all traumatic events ARE remembered, and quite clearly.

Electrical brain activity in relaxed or hypnotic states indicates that hypnosis is no more of a special state of consciousness than it is a social role playing. Patients show a response to hypnosis out of the expectation that it will work, or that they should be acting a certain way. They give the hypnotist the authority to suggest things to them, then they follow them of their own volition.
